Custom Cocktail Dresses — Interlock Knit with Snow Wash

We build cocktail dresses programmes from a tech pack or a physical reference sample. This Interlock Knit version is developed for brands that need a repeatable specification: the same cloth, the same hand feel and the same fit on every reorder. Fabric, trims, snow wash and packaging are all specifiable, so the garment stays consistent across seasons and across production runs.

Most buyers come to us after one of these problems: minimum order quantities far above what a growing brand can absorb, or long lead times that miss the selling season. Our response is to fix the specification first — fabric weight, shrinkage allowance, stitch density and tolerance — before a single bulk metre is cut.

How we produce it

  1. Tech pack review and fabric confirmation
  2. Lab dips or print strike-off for approval
  3. Pattern making, grading and a Interlock Knit-spec prototype
  4. Fit sample and wearer test, then a pre-production sample
  5. Bulk cutting with snow wash applied under controlled settings
  6. In-line inspection, final AQL 2.5 inspection and packing

Quality control

Every bulk order is checked against the approved sample for shade, hand feel, measurements and workmanship. We record shrinkage, colour fastness and seam strength on the first bulk lot and hold the data as the reference for reorders, so cocktail dresses batches stay comparable over time. Inspection photos and the measurement report are sent before the balance payment is due.

FAQ

What is the minimum order quantity?

Standard programmes start at 200 pieces per style and colour. We can split sizes across a size set, and for first orders we often accept a mixed-colour run to help you test the market.

Do you provide compliance documents?

We can arrange OEKO-TEX, GOTS, BSCI, WRAP and ISO documentation as well as third-party testing reports for GOTS, and we support REACH, CPSIA and Prop 65 declarations for the relevant markets.

What file formats do you need for artwork?

Vector files (AI, EPS, PDF) give the best print and embroidery results. For raster artwork please supply at least 300 dpi at the final print size. We digitise embroidery files in-house and return a sew-out photo for approval.

How long does sampling take?

A first prototype is typically ready in 10 working days after the tech pack is confirmed, including fabric sourcing if the base cloth is not in our stock library. Revisions add about 5 days each.
